Obverse description Round cast brass cash coin with a central square perforation, following the traditional Chinese yuan-fang-kong (round coin, square hole) format. The field bears four characters in regular script (kaishu) arranged in a cruciform pattern around the central aperture, reading clockwise from top: 隆 (Lóng), 通 (Tōng), 武 (Wǔ), 寶 (Bǎo), together forming the reign-title legend 隆武通寶 (Lóngwǔ Tōngbǎo). The raised characters are bold and well-defined in style, set within a plain, unadorned field bounded by a slightly raised inner rim surrounding the square hole and a raised outer rim encircling the coin's edge. The surface exhibits a patina of brown and dark green consistent with aged brass.
